A decision framework generator hands you simple lenses for making a tough call clearer when you are stuck going in circles. Choose how many you want and it returns a shuffled set — is it reversible, what is the cost of doing nothing, the 10/10/10 test, the year-from-now pre-mortem. Leaders and teams use these because most hard decisions are not short on data, they are short on structure; a framework turns a tangled feeling into a few answerable questions. Different frameworks suit different calls: reversibility for speed, weighted scoring for comparable options, a pre-mortem for risky bets. Pick one or two that fit the decision in front of you, run your options through them, and notice how quickly the right path tends to surface. The goal is not to remove judgement but to give it something solid to push against.

Tips
- →Decide fast on reversible calls, slowly on permanent ones.
- →Name what you are optimising for before comparing.
- →Check your gut choice against the analysis.
- →Set a deadline so the decision cannot drift.
FAQ
which framework should i use
Match it to the call: reversibility for speed, weighted scoring for comparable options, a pre-mortem for risky bets. Most decisions need structure more than they need more data.
can i combine frameworks
Yes. A common combo is naming your gut choice, then running the analysis to check it. When the two agree, decide; when they clash, that tension is worth examining.
do frameworks replace judgement
No — they sharpen it. A framework turns a vague feeling into answerable questions, but you still make the call. It gives your judgement something solid to push against.
